Abstract

The invention belongs to the field of construction product production, and particularly discloses a production process for a decoration board. The production process includes the following procedures of (1) mold pretreatment, (2) ingredient mixing, (3) distributing, (4) maintaining, (5) demolding and (6) decoration board aftertreatment. A mold is subjected to treatment of the first procedure on a first conveying line and is transferred to a second conveying line to be subjected to the third procedure, and then the mold completing distribution is conveyed to a third conveying line through a ferry device to be subjected to operation of other procedures after the third procedure. The second conveying line comprises two or more pouring lines which are connected in parallel. An integral-molding production mode is adopted, a pre-decoration layer and a structure layer are combined into a product, the production mode is suitable for a construction industrial assembling system, the defects of low safety factor, uncontrollable quality, high construction cost, low efficiency, environment pollution and the like of traditional external decoration modes such as paint coating, ceramic tile pasting and dry hanging are overcome, and the productivity can be effectively increased.

technical field [0001] The invention belongs to the field of building component production, and in particular relates to a production process of a decorative board. Background technique [0002] The thermal insulation and decoration integrated board is a thermal insulation and decoration system placed on the surface of the building. It has excellent thermal insulation effect, less thermal bridge effect, and good energy-saving thermal insulation effect. As the main component of the integration of decoration, energy saving and building, the thermal insulation and decoration integrated board is fixed to the main body of the building through a similar and compatible pasting system and fixed connection system. The thermal insulation and decoration integrated board has the characteristics of good stability, low construction difficulty and short cycle.
